'Field-Convolvulus', 1877. Field-Convolvulus, Bindweed or Morning Glory, (Convolvulus arvensis) is a a climbing herbaceous perennial. From "Familiar Wild Flowers", figured and described by F. Edward Hulme, F.L.S., F.S.A. [Cassell & Company, Limited; London, Paris & New York, 1877]
